Africa-linked deep-tech startup ChipMango has raised $1.9 million in funding to expand its semiconductor engineering operations, train more chip-design engineers and grow its presence across Africa, the United States and Europe.
The funding round was led by Atlantica Ventures, with participation from DFS, Kaleo Ventures, Madica, Trilinear Technologies, Malta Ventures and other strategic investors.
The investment places ChipMango among a relatively small group of African-linked startups tackling the semiconductor industry — an area that could become increasingly important as artificial intelligence drives global demand for chips, intelligent hardware and specialised engineering talent.
Building Africa’s chip-design talent
Founded by Ola Fadiran and Jovan Andjelich, ChipMango operates at the intersection of semiconductor engineering, artificial intelligence and skills development.
Rather than manufacturing physical semiconductor chips, the company focuses on chip design and verification, while simultaneously developing engineers capable of working on commercial semiconductor projects.
Its model involves training engineers using industry-aligned tools and workflows before deploying that talent on commercial semiconductor programmes.
The company believes Africa’s growing pool of engineering talent could play a bigger role in the global semiconductor value chain.

Funding will accelerate engineering and AI development
ChipMango plans to use the new capital to increase its engineering and product-development capacity and take on additional commercial chip-design projects.
The startup will also expand its AI-native learning and workforce platform, while investing further in edge AI, intelligent sensors and hardware technologies.
Another major part of the strategy is international expansion.
ChipMango plans to grow its operations across Africa, Europe and the United States, including establishing a European Design Centre in Malta in partnership with Malta Ventures.
In Africa, the company is also working on initiatives in Kigali, Rwanda, focused on developing semiconductor capabilities, engineering talent and AI infrastructure.
South Africa plays a role in ChipMango’s strategy
South Africa is already part of ChipMango’s growing semiconductor ecosystem.
The company works with the Carl and Emily Fuchs Institute for Microelectronics at the University of Pretoria, alongside international technology and academic partners including Synopsys and Ohlone College in California.
The partnerships are aimed at narrowing the gap between academic engineering education and the practical skills required to work on commercial semiconductor programmes.
ChipMango is also an Arm Approved Training Partner, enabling it to provide official training around Arm technologies.
Its training platform gives engineers browser-based access to professional semiconductor design environments and electronic design automation tools similar to those used in commercial chip-development projects.
Taking African engineering talent global
ChipMango’s strategy comes at a time when the global semiconductor industry is facing a shortage of specialised engineers.
Rather than attempting to compete immediately in the extremely capital-intensive business of manufacturing chips, ChipMango is targeting the design and engineering portion of the semiconductor value chain.
This potentially allows African engineers to participate in international semiconductor programmes without requiring billions of dollars to construct fabrication facilities on the continent.
Atlantica Ventures founding partner Anikó Szigetvári believes the availability of skilled engineers is becoming one of the industry’s biggest constraints.
“The semiconductor industry’s binding constraint is no longer capital, it is people,” Szigetvári said.
She added that ChipMango is demonstrating the potential to turn Africa’s engineering talent into globally competitive chip-design capabilities.
Commercial projects already underway
ChipMango is not relying exclusively on training.
The startup also provides commercial semiconductor engineering and verification services to technology companies.
One example is its work with Trilinear Technologies, which develops high-performance DisplayPort and multimedia intellectual property for systems-on-chip, FPGAs and ASICs.
ChipMango engineers support verification work that helps Trilinear increase its engineering capacity across consumer, automotive and industrial applications.
This creates an interesting business model for the startup: ChipMango can develop semiconductor engineers through its training ecosystem and deploy that talent into revenue-generating international engineering projects.
Deep tech emerges as Africa’s next startup frontier
The $1.9 million raise also highlights a broader shift taking place within Africa’s startup ecosystem.
While fintech, e-commerce and logistics have traditionally attracted much of the continent’s venture capital, startups are increasingly exploring deeper layers of technology including artificial intelligence infrastructure, semiconductor engineering and advanced hardware.
For ChipMango, the opportunity lies in positioning African engineers as participants in the technologies underpinning the global AI boom rather than simply consumers of them.
